"I am a Taiwanese": Eastern Europeans see a Cold War in East Asia

“I am a Taiwanese”: Eastern Europeans see a Cold War in East Asia Memories of life under authoritarianism forge ties between Taiwan and a growing number of Eastern European states. The visit of Czech Senate President Miloš Vystrčil (L) to Taipei in September 2020, against the wishes of his president, caused Beijing to announce that he would pay a “heavy price” (Annabelle Chih/SOPA Images/LightRocket via Getty Images) Published 5 Aug 2021 07:00   0 Comments   The politics of the Baltic states do not often create much of a stir in East Asia. That changed in October last year when the prime minister-elect of Lithuania, Ingrida Šimonytė, proclaimed shortly after her victory that the new ruling coalition would support those who “fight for freedom” in Taiwan. If such statements ruffled feathers in Beijing at the time, more recent actions have upped the ante.
